Guidebook to the 1250km of Spains Sendero Historico (GR1), traversing northern Spain from Puerto de Tarna in the province of Leon in the west to the Mediterranean near LEscala in Catalonia, through fascinating, varied landscapes and the foothills of the Pyrenees. Described in 53 stages, about 25km each in length, with detailed mapping.

21 half and full-day cycle routes, and a 4-day 200km Tour of the Cotswolds
This guide's 21 day routes and four-day 200km tour describe the best cycling to be had in the marvellous Cotswolds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ty in south-west England, which boasts cycle-friendly lanes, canal paths and bridleways as well as scarp slopes and rolling hills. The guide details gear, cycle hire, repair and pre-ride checks.

Pilgrimage from Culross and North Queensferry to St Andrews
A guidebook to walking the Fife Pilgrim Way from Culross on the Firth of Forth through the heart of the ancient Kingdom of Fife to St Andrews on Scotland's North Sea coast. Covering 103km (64 miles), this fully waymarked trail takes around 6 days to hike. The route is described from south to north in 6 stages between 14 and 16km (8-10 ......

Selected snow, ice and mixed routes in a two-volume set
A selection of hundreds of the best winter climbs on Ben Nevis and in the Glen Coe area, categorised by type, from straightforward Grade I snow gullies and ridges through to extreme test pieces above Grade VIII. Includes notes on their formation and advice to help maximise your chances of finding the best conditions.
